4. Dwaine Pretorius

Dwaine Pretorius played the role of the designated death-over bowler in South Africa’s bowling attack. And there is no denying that he stood up to the task quite well. Pretorius varied his lengths brilliantly and that kept the batsmen guessing.
Despite bowling most of his overs at the death, Pretorius gave away runs at less than 7 an over. He finished with 9 wickets in 5 matches and gave South Africa the best chance to reach the semis. His average of 11.22 is the best amongst all his allies in the team, which tells you how effective he was throughout the tournament.
